The centre is Hua Cheng at level 2. Charges are $330 for 11 lessons. Need to take a mini test to gauge your child's standard.
My P2 dd is attending the above centre's ACE program. their P2 class is on every wed from 9 to 11am. Currently there's abt six kids, all PH students. The teacher make the kids do reading out loud in the class to help them with oral. They have ting xie too.
They have another class on fri that tackles mainly on compo and compre. Their recommendation for my dd is to take the ACE program class rather than the compo and compre class cos her vocab not powerful.
